NevadaLand Productions LLC, who co-ops with the Historic Fourth Ward School Museum in Virginia City in teaching an annual youth filmmaking class, has partnered with the University of Nevada, Reno along with the museum to offer an intensive summer internship to the undergraduate students from the Reynolds School of Journalism filmmaking program.

The interns not only gain hands-on, real experience on set, they are also team teaching the youth filmmaking class as well as assisting with the First Comstock Film Festival to be held at the Fourth Ward School Museum Sept. 20-22.

Short film submissions are being accepted through Aug. 31. A unique component of this festival is the various master classes that will be taught by industry experts such as an acting class with Baywatch director Tracy Britton and a screenwriting class with award-winning director Liza Asner.

There will also be a microfilm competition held during the festival for youth filmmakers with a prize going to the winner.
